Output 057cc49ef0a7a2ee17e5d27887d6c55508a4d29a9528bbefd50428ede4c4ca1e:3

value
20886317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19034dbcc16d97d379faf2742b2d33a2264cdd10 OP_EQUAL
address
MABR5mX3esayH8qwQUfp1wr113FsrdsR4P
transaction
057cc49ef0a7a2ee17e5d27887d6c55508a4d29a9528bbefd50428ede4c4ca1e
spent
true